Reviving Dry Carrots and Dehydrated Celery

January 18, 2011 by Erin, The $5 Dinner Mom 4 Comments

(Please pardon the iPhone photo.) A little trick I learned back in my early cooking days in the Dominican Republic... When you see baby carrots, carrot sticks, and celery stalks starting to dehydrate or go limp, all they need is a little water to revive them!  Simply place them into a container with some water.  When I have baby carrots or cut carrot sticks go … [Read more...]
